A local primary school in Milton Keynes is seeking a Child-Centred Primary Teacher to join their team. The role requires planning and delivering engaging lessons while fostering a positive and inclusive environment for all students.
Ideal candidates will have UK Qualified Teacher Status and a commitment to child-centred teaching. This position offers competitive daily rates of 120+ and can be either full-time or part-time, starting as soon as possible.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aspire People
✨Know Your Child-Centred Approach
Make sure you can articulate what child-centred teaching means to you. Prepare examples of how you've successfully engaged students in the past, focusing on their individual needs and interests.
✨Plan a Sample Lesson
Be ready to discuss or even present a sample lesson plan during your interview. This shows your ability to plan engaging lessons and demonstrates your understanding of the curriculum for KS1 and KS2.
✨Show Your Passion for Inclusivity
Highlight your commitment to creating an inclusive environment. Think of specific strategies you've used to ensure all students feel valued and included in your classroom activities.
✨Research the School
Familiarise yourself with the school's ethos and values. Knowing their approach to education will help you tailor your responses and show that you're genuinely interested in being part of their team.
